Full Time Family Finds Their Calling

full time rv lifestyle rv shades blog Sometimes it’s just amazing the way things work out just when you need them to. I recently read a great story about a man named Todd Seeley, who after working full time laboring in a coal mine, never seeing family and putting his health at risk, decided he wanted to leave his job, sell the family home, buy an RV, and hit the road for a lifestyle of full time RVing. Their home had been on the market, to no avail. In speaking with their pastor, he suggested they talk to some other members of the congregation who happened to be RV’ers and ran a business from their RV. By the end of this conversation, Todd and Renee Seeley had purchased not only the business from the couple, but also their motorhome. That same day they leased out their home and it all fell into place. The Seeley’s and their son, Seth are now full time RV’ers who make custom RV window shades. They’re not just any window shades… They are made from a special fabric that allows the RV occupants to see out, but does not allow the outside passersby to see in (unless it’s dark out). The blinds attach to the outside of the windows, thusly blocking the rays from ever hitting the glass and in turn keeping temperatures inside the RV greatly reduced. They split their time mainly between Texas, Arizona, and Missouri, but travel all over the US. They typically work from whatever campground they are staying in, and business is often generated by other campers coming to check out the jobs they’re working on. In their interview with Greg Gerber of the rvdailyreport.com, the Seeley’s said, “I don’t ever see us going back to a regular job…You can’t make the money you need and you have no control of your life.  Today, we have complete control over our income. If we need more money, we take on more orders. If we need time off, we try to find a campground where we can hide out for a few days”.  The Seeley’s went on to say that for them the best part about full-time RVing is the options it provides. “It is so hard to think about making $20 to $30 an hour working in a coal mine, risking my health and safety, and being overall unhappy about my situation.  If you have a major expense at home, all you can do is try to work overtime or find a part-time job to bring in more money.  When you live in sticks and bricks, you are tied to an area and it is very hard to uproot and change your situation.  For us, if we run out of work, we don’t like the weather or don’t like our neighbors, we can be packed up and out of here in 30 minutes.
